MWE:

example (l : List Nat) : l.get = l.get := _
Context

n/a

Steps to Reproduce
  1. put cursor on _ in MWE
  2. hover over get in expected type

Expected behavior: See List.get docstring, possibly followed by field notation documentation

Actual behavior: Only field notation docs are shown

Versions

4.16.0-rc2
